Does Your Soccer Club Utilize a Data Analyst to Optimize Performance?
In the fast-paced world of professional soccer, every advantage counts. That’s why many top clubs are now turning to data analysts to help optimize their players’ performance on the field. By utilizing advanced analytics, teams can gain valuable insights into their players’ strengths and weaknesses, as well as their opponents’ tendencies and strategies.
Benefits of Having a Data Analyst in a Soccer Club:
- Identifying key performance indicators for each player
- Creating customized training programs based on data insights
- Analyzing match data to make tactical adjustments during games
- Improving player recruitment and scouting efforts
With the rise of technologies like GPS tracking, player tracking systems, and video analysis tools, data analysts are now able to provide coaches and players with a wealth of data to help them reach their full potential. By leveraging this data effectively, soccer clubs can gain a competitive edge and increase their chances of success on the pitch.

Why Every Soccer Club Should Invest in Data Analytics
In today’s competitive world of soccer, data analytics has become an essential tool for clubs looking to gain a competitive edge. By leveraging data to analyze player performance, opposition tactics, and even fan engagement, clubs can make more informed decisions that can lead to success on and off the field.
One of the main reasons is the ability to track and analyze player performance. By collecting data on key performance indicators such as passing accuracy, distance covered, and shots on target, clubs can identify areas for improvement and tailor training sessions to address these weaknesses.
Additionally, data analytics can help clubs scout new talent more efficiently. By analyzing player data from different leagues and competitions, clubs can identify promising young players who may have gone unnoticed by traditional scouting methods. This can give clubs a significant advantage in the transfer market and help them build a strong squad for the future.
Furthermore, data analytics can also be used to better understand fan trends and behavior. By analyzing data on ticket sales, merchandise purchases, and social media engagement, clubs can tailor their marketing campaigns to better reach and engage with their fan base. This can ultimately lead to increased revenue and a more loyal fan following.
